Dominate Your Money: A Guide to Personal Finance Budgeting

Taking authority of your finances can feel overwhelming, but it doesn't have to be. A well-structured budget is the foundation for achieving your financial goals, whether that's saving for a retirement or simply feeling more confident about your spending habits. By tracking where your money goes and creating a plan to allocate it effectively, you can optimize your financial situation.

  • The first step is to determine your current income and expenses. Record every dollar coming in and going out for a month to get a clear picture of your cash flow.
  • Categorize your expenses into fixed costs like housing, food, and transportation, and discretionary expenses such as entertainment, dining out, and subscriptions.
  • Identify areas where you can trim spending. Even small changes can make a big difference over time.

Apply your budget by setting financial goals and creating a plan to achieve them. Periodically review and modify your budget as your situation change. Remember, budgeting is not about limiting yourself but about making strategic choices with your money to live a more fulfilling life.

Personal Finance Made Easy: Budgeting Strategies for Success

Taking control of your finances can seem daunting, but with the right budgeting strategies, you can make it a breeze. The fundamental step is to record your income and expenses carefully. Utilize a budgeting app, spreadsheet, or even just a notebook to categorize your spending. Once you have a clear understanding of where your money is going, you can pinpoint areas where you can reduce expenses.

  • Establish realistic financial goals to keep motivated. Whether it's saving for a down payment on a house, paying off debt, or simply building an emergency fund, having clear objectives will help you adhere to your budget.
  • Automate your savings by setting up automatic transfers from your checking account to your savings account. This promotes that you regularly put money aside, even when you're busy or inclined to spend.
  • Evaluate your budget weekly and make adjustments as needed. Life is constantly changing, so it's important to refine your budget accordingly to represent your current needs and goals.

By following these simple budgeting strategies, you can obtain control of your finances and set yourself up for a secure financial future. Remember, it's not about deprivation; it's about making deliberate choices that support your financial well-being.

Conquer Debt and Build Wealth: A Practical Approach to Personal Finance

Starting a journey toward financial freedom can feel overwhelming, but it doesn't have to be. By implementing a few key strategies, you can effectively manage existing debts and lay a strong foundation for wealth building. The first step is to create a detailed budget that monitors your income and expenses. This will give you a clear picture of where your money is going and identify areas where you can make savings.

  • Then, focus on paying off high-interest debts first. This will help you avoid money on interest charges in the long run.
  • Explore options for reducing monthly payments to make your debt more manageable.
  • Alongside, establish an emergency fund to cover unexpected expenses and avoid falling back into debt.
